Neuroimaging information have revealed 3 networks related to different title= s12967-016-1023-5 aspects of attention: alerting, orienting, and executive control (Posner Petersen, 1990). Alerting is defined as keeping a state of high sensitivity to incoming stimuli, and is associated with all the frontal and parietal regions of the right hemisphere (Marrocco Davidson, 1998). Orienting will be the selection of info from sensory input, and it is connected with posterior brain areas which includes the superior parietal lobe (associated to the lateral intraparietal area in monkeys), the temporal parietal junction as well as the frontal eye fields (Corbetta, Kincade, Ollinger, McAvoy, Shulman, 2000; Posner, 1980). Lastly, executive control is defined as involving the mechanisms for resolving conflict among achievable responses. It activates the anterior cingulate as well as the lateral prefrontal cortex (Botvinick, Braver, Barch, Carter, Cohen, 2001; Bush, Luu, Posner, 2000).1 This attention network impacts visual processing, which is one particular of your most efficient strategies to boost the stimulus representation for the objective of choice. Generally, the influence of consideration increases along the hierarchy from the cortical visual locations, resulting in a neural representation from the visual world affected by behavioral relevance in the facts, at the expense of an precise and comprehensive description of it (e.g., Treue, 2001). Realizing that behavioral relevance modulates neural representation led to a reconceptualization of places that had been thought of to be `purely sensory'.
